Output e03756c5ab51064054634e31dbadfe6a817cb8b27dae278add9f3c3020f8fa8c:27

value
7390589097
script pubkey
OP_0 OP_PUSHBYTES_32 beac0b036ee1f20b34c9457f5d2c72558d059179e771f86ad11b41973e349cd7
address
bc1qh6kqkqmwu8eqkdxfg4l46trj2kxstyteuacls6k3rdqew035nntsgreqsf
transaction
e03756c5ab51064054634e31dbadfe6a817cb8b27dae278add9f3c3020f8fa8c
spent
true